It's pretty common to have a separation. By the time you've had 3 pregnancies, I think something like 80-90% of women will have some degree of muscle splitting. Only consider surgery if you're done having kids! Pilates is supposed to be good, but no crunches - I discovered I had a separation on my own after DS, and just doing pilates pretty much closed it right up. However, it was only about 2-3 fingers to start with.
